WebJul 3, 2024 · The first part of "Erewhon" written was an article headed "Darwin among the Machines," and signed Cellarius. It was written in the Upper Rangitata district of the Canterbury Province (as it then was) of New Zealand, and appeared at Christchurch in the Press Newspaper, June 13, 1863.

Web“Erewhon” or “Over the Range” is a novel that the author, Samuel Butler published first in 1872. Many of his novels are mold with a mild satiric tone towards society. His novels express criticism of Victorian society. The word means “nowhere”. This is basically fictional that tells a story of exploration.

His novels … green pacific solarWebErewhon, Or Over the Range - Samuel Butler 2024-04-07 Erewhon: or, Over the Range is a novel by Samuel Butler which was first published anonymously in 1872.The title is also the name of a country, supposedly discovered by the protagonist. green pacific counseling \u0026 psychology incWebAug 28, 2024 · Higgs, the narrator of Erewhon has left England, hinting at a troubled past, for a British colony. Here he finds work at a sheep station, filling his days in isolation by tracking and catching sheep that have escaped their herds. He hopes to one day make his fortune by having a farm of his own. flynn hatch act
